CVE-2023-20273: Cisco IOS XE Web UI Command Injection Vulnerability

CVE ID

CVE-2023-20273

Vulnerability Name

Cisco IOS XE Web UI Command Injection Vulnerability

  • Project: Cisco
  • Product: Cisco IOS XE Web UI

Date

  • Date Added: 2023-10-23
  • Due Date: 2023-10-27

Description

Cisco IOS XE contains a command injection vulnerability in the web user interface. When chained with CVE-2023-20198, the attacker can leverage the new local user to elevate privilege to root and write the implant to the file system. Cisco identified CVE-2023-20273 as the vulnerability exploited to deploy the implant. CVE-2021-1435, previously associated with the exploitation events, is no longer believed to be related to this activity.

Known To Be Used in Ransomware Campaigns?

Unknown

Action

Verify that instances of Cisco IOS XE Web UI are in compliance with BOD 23-02 and apply mitigations per vendor instructions. For affected products (Cisco IOS XE Web UI exposed to the internet or to untrusted networks), follow vendor instructions to determine if a system may have been compromised and immediately report positive findings to CISA.
